An example of this genre is Samuel Richardson's Pamela, or Virtue Rewarded (1740), composed "to cultivate the Principles of Advantage and Religion during the Minds of your Youth of The two Sexes", which concentrates on a potential target, a heroine which includes all the fashionable virtues and who is susceptible for the reason that her reduced social status and her occupation as servant of a libertine who falls in adore along with her. She, having said that, finishes in reforming her antagonist.[citation required]

The therapy of the topic of war changed with Leo Tolstoy's War and Peace (1868/69), where by he queries the points provided by historians. Likewise the cure of criminal offense is quite distinctive in Fyodor Dostoyevsky's Criminal offense and Punishment (1866), exactly where the viewpoint is usually that of the felony. Gals authors experienced dominated fiction in the 1640s to the early 18th century, but several before George Eliot so openly questioned the function, schooling, and status of women in society, as she did.
